Facebookの顔認証技術『DeepFace』

FacebookがCVPR2014に出したDeepFaceの日本語解説記事見つけた。
http://research.preferred.jp/2014/03/face-verification-deepface-and-pyramid-cnn/

DeepFace の論文では、検出された顔矩形に対して以下の3つの処理を施しています。

  • 矩形の2次元アラインメント
  • 3次元モデルを用いた out-of-plane のアラインメント
  • アラインメントされた画像を Deep Neural Network (DNN) に入力して顔表現ベクトルを得る
  • 得られた顔表現ベクトルをもとに2つの顔矩形を比べて、同一人物化どうかを判定する

う、難しいからじっくり読む(日本語記事を)

関連記事

fSpy:1枚の写真からカメラパラメーターを割り出すツール

OpenCV 3.1のsfmモジュールを試す

ManimML:機械学習の概念を視覚的に説明するためのライブラリ

OpenGV:画像からカメラの3次元位置・姿勢を推定するライブラリ

OpenCVの三角測量関数『cv::triangulatepoints』

Kinect for Windows V2のプレオーダー開始

SDカードサイズのコンピューター『Intel Edison』

Runway ML:クリエイターのための機械学習ツール

YOLO (You Only Look Once):ディープラーニングによる一般物体検出手法

顔検出・認識のAPI・ライブラリ・ソフトウェアのリスト

Active Appearance Models(AAM)

今年もSSII

Digital Emily Project:人間の顔をそっくりそのままCGで復元する

続・ディープラーニングの資料

SSII 2014 デモンストレーションセッションのダイジェスト動画

R-CNN (Regions with CNN features):ディープラーニングによる一般物体...

OpenCVの超解像(SuperResolution)モジュールを試す

Deep Fluids:流体シミュレーションをディープラーニングで近似する

ArUco:OpenCVベースのコンパクトなARライブラリ

Alice Vision:オープンソースのPhotogrammetryフレームワーク

3Dスキャンに基づくプロシージャルフェイシャルアニメーション

Mitsuba 3:オープンソースの研究向けレンダラ

TensorSpace.js:ニューラルネットワークの構造を可視化するフレームワーク

OpenCV 3.3.0-RCでsfmモジュールをビルド

SVM (Support Vector Machine)

2D→3D復元技術で使われる用語まとめ

Accord.NET Framework:C#で使える機械学習ライブラリ

PyDataTokyo主催のDeep Learning勉強会

AnacondaとTensorFlowをインストールしてVisual Studio 2015で使う

Unityで強化学習できる『Unity ML-Agents』

OpenCV 3.1とopencv_contribモジュールをVisual Studio 2015で...

OpenCVで顔のランドマークを検出する『Facemark API』

Kaolin:3Dディープラーニング用のPyTorchライブラリ

OpenFace:Deep Neural Networkによる顔の個人識別フレームワーク

Pix2Pix:CGANによる画像変換

書籍『3次元コンピュータビジョン計算ハンドブック』を購入

DUSt3R:3Dコンピュータービジョンの基盤モデル

AfterEffectsプラグイン開発

Leap MotionでMaya上のオブジェクトを操作できるプラグイン

BlenderでPhotogrammetryできるアドオン

BlenderProc:Blenderで機械学習用の画像データを生成するPythonツール

openMVG:複数視点画像から3次元形状を復元するライブラリ

コメント